The Importance of Accurate Measurements

When it comes to landscaping and outdoor design, accuracy is key. Knowing the exact square footage of your yard allows you to plan and execute your vision with precision. Whether you're working with a professional landscaper or taking on the project yourself, accurate measurements will ensure that you have the right amount of materials, from plants and flowers to paving stones and mulch.

Accurate measurements are also essential when it comes to budgeting. By knowing the square footage of your yard, you can estimate the cost of materials and labor more accurately, helping you avoid any unwelcome surprises along the way. Additionally, accurate measurements can be useful when applying for permits or complying with local building codes, as many regulations are based on property size.

To measure the square footage of your yard, start by breaking it down into smaller, more manageable sections. If your yard has irregular shapes or features, divide it into squares or rectangles and measure each section separately. Once you have the measurements for each section, add them together to determine the total square footage. Alternatively, you can use online tools or hire a professional surveyor to accurately measure your yard.

Maximizing Space with Strategic Landscaping

Now that you have a clear understanding of the square footage of your yard, it's time to explore how to make the most of the available space. Strategic landscaping can transform a small yard into a cozy retreat or turn a large yard into an expansive paradise. By carefully planning and designing your outdoor space, you can create different zones for various activities and maximize functionality.

One effective strategy for maximizing space is to create levels or tiers within your yard. By adding retaining walls, terraces, or raised beds, you can create distinct areas that serve different purposes. For example, you could have a dining area on one level, a lounging area on another, and a play area for children on yet another. This not only adds visual interest but also maximizes the usable square footage of your yard.

Another way to make the most of your yard's square footage is to incorporate vertical elements. By utilizing walls, fences, or trellises, you can create vertical gardens or hang potted plants, freeing up valuable ground space. Vertical gardening not only adds a unique aesthetic to your yard but also allows you to grow more plants and flowers in a limited area.

Creating a Functional Outdoor Living Space

When it comes to designing your yard, functionality is key. Creating a functional outdoor living space ensures that you can enjoy your yard to its fullest potential, regardless of its square footage. Whether you have a small, cozy yard or a sprawling estate, there are several elements you can incorporate to enhance the functionality of your outdoor space.

First and foremost, consider the activities you enjoy and how you envision using your yard. Do you love to entertain? If so, a spacious patio or deck with ample seating and a built-in grill might be a priority. Are you a gardener at heart? Then allocating space for a vegetable garden or a flower bed might be at the top of your list. By identifying your needs and priorities, you can design your yard accordingly, ensuring that it serves your lifestyle.

Additionally, think about how you can extend the usability of your yard beyond the daytime. Incorporating outdoor lighting, such as string lights or solar-powered lanterns, allows you to enjoy your yard well into the evening hours. Adding heating elements, such as fire pits or outdoor heaters, can also make your yard more comfortable during cooler seasons, further maximizing its usability.
